White gunk on oil dipstick?

Well, i was doing my once a week check on the oil (but I check it more like 3-5 times a week) and I had not driven my FC in the past 3-4 days, and before I turned it on, I found some white gunk around the oil dipstick. is this a "bad" sign?

I know when i had my DSM, finding white gunk around the oil cap, meant the head gasket is about to go, or SOMETHING along those lines.
